Alabama running back Trey Sanders was involved in a car accident on Friday, but the redshirt freshman didn’t suffer any significant injuries, BamaOnLine has learned. Sanders was home in Port Saint Joe, Fla., as the Crimson Tide has the weekend off during its bye week.

Head coach Nick Saban released the following statement Friday afternoon: “Trey Sanders was involved in a car accident this morning and is in stable condition after sustaining non-life threating injuries. We are in direct contact with his family and the physicians that are treating him as we continue to gather more information.”

According to a report from WMBB News 13, Sanders was in the car with his older brother, Umstead. Sanders had to be life-flighted to Bay Medical with non-life threatening injuries. ...

Details are starting to come together regarding a Friday accident that involved Alabama running back Trey Sanders.

According to WMBB-TV’s Courtney Mims, the accident occurred in the morning hours as Sanders was driving with his older brother, Umstead, a Jacksonville State linebacker who transferred from Florida in February. They were then struck at an intersection in Clarksville, Florida, but fortunately, the injuries were not life-threatening. However, the younger Sanders was airlifted to nearby Bay Medical Center in Panama City for further evaluation...

You cannot read anything into those terms. HIPPA allows hospitals to release simple, usually one word descriptions of a patient’s general condition. Lots of providers dumb it down to life threatening or non-life threatening.

Non-life threatening could mean anything from the patient lost a leg to we put a couple of stitches in his butt and sent him home. It’s sorta the medical version of coachspeak.

Eta - I can virtually guarantee you at least one part of that SDS story is wrong. It says Sanders was driving with his brother and was airlifted. That car was clearly struck by the SUV on the passenger side door. Nothing about the mechanism of injury suggests a risk of significant injury to the driver. Hell, the door still opens. The one at high risk was the front seat passenger. If Sanders was flown, he wasn’t driving.
